Overview
Dr. Matthew Present is a highly qualified and dedicated pediatrician located in Rochester, NY, specializing in General Pediatrics. He earned his medical degree from the University of Chicago Division of Biological Sciences Pritzker School of Medicine in 2019 and has completed his residency in Pediatrics at Strong Memorial Hospital of the University of Rochester from 2019 to 2022, accumulating over four years of experience in the field.
